What is Impulse Testing of Transformers?

impulse testing of transformers indicates a type of test that evaluates the insulation system's ability to withstand transient high voltages. This test is crucial in ensuring the reliability and safety of transformers in various applications.

Importance of Impulse Testing

Impulse testing of transformers indicates the equipment's ability to withstand lightning strikes or switching surges that could potentially damage the transformer. By assessing the insulation's response to these impulses, operators can prevent costly breakdowns and ensure optimal performance.

Testing Procedures

During impulse testing of transformers, high voltage impulses are applied to the winding to check the insulation's integrity. The test measures the voltage response and assesses the insulation's ability to withstand transient surges.
